How We Calculate Calories Burned for Disc Golf in Reading

Our calculator uses the standard MET (Metabolic Equivalent of Task) formula with a local climate adjustment for Reading:

Calories = MET × Weight (kg) × Duration (hrs) × Climate Factor

= 3.5 × Weight (kg) × Duration (hrs) × 1.03

The MET value of 3.5 for disc golf is sourced from the Compendium of Physical Activities. The climate factor of 1.03 is Calorique's planning adjustment for Reading's average temperature of 47°F. Disc golf involves throwing a flying disc into metal baskets across a course of 9 or 18 holes, similar to traditional golf but more accessible and affordable. Players walk the course carrying their discs, covering 1-3 miles per round over varied terrain including hills and wooded paths. The throwing motion engages the core, shoulders, and hips through a rotational power movement. Disc golf provides a relaxing outdoor workout that combines cardiovascular benefits from walking with upper body engagement from throwing.
